Changes of blood biochemical values in ponies recovering from hyperlipemia in Japan.

Abstract: Hyperlipemia in horses is a disorder of lipid metabolism peculiar to ponies. This study reports changes of blood biochemical values from the acute to the postconvalescent phases in 3 Shetland ponies with hyperlipemia in Japan. Diseased ponies (all 7 to 9 years old, in late pregnancy, and obese) were fed in the same farm. The periods of their hospitalizations ranged from 30 to 45 days. Twelve well-conditioned ponies (3 to 13 years old) around parturition were used to establish baseline values for blood test results. Main clinical findings in the affected ponies were depression, dysphagia, anorexia, ventral edema and milky-appearing plasma. Hypertriglyceridemia (40- to 70-fold rise of controls) was found in the acute phase of the disease in the affected ponies, and was derived from increased very-low density lipoproteins. Aspartate transaminase and gamma-glutamyl transpeptidase activities, blood urea nitrogen, and creatinin concentrations were increased in acute ponies compared to controls, suggesting impairment of liver and kidney functions. However, these values gradually recovered until the end of postconvalescent phase. Hyperinsulinemia was observed in the acute phase of the hyperlipemia of all affected ponies. And an exaggerated insulin response to intravenous glucose was observed in the 2 ponies given intravenous glucose tolerance tests. These findings suggest decreased insulin sensitivity in hyperlipemic ponies.

The research article looks into the changes in blood biochemical values in Shetland ponies suffering from hyperlipemia in Japan, with a particular focus on differences during the acute phase and postconvalescent recovery period.

Study Overview

  • Three Shetland ponies, all between 7 to 9 years old, in late pregnancy, and obese were studied. They were all fed in the same farm, and their hospitalization periods varied between 30 to 45 days.
  • The research studies changes in their blood biochemical values from the acute phase of the disease to the postconvalescent phase.
  • Twelve well-conditioned ponies were used as controls to establish the baseline values for blood test results.

Key Findings

  • During the acute phase, ponies demonstrated depression, anorexia, dysphagia, ventral edema, and milky-appearing plasma.
  • These ponies also exhibited hypertriglyceridemia in the acute phase, which was due to increased very-low density lipoproteins.
  • It was observed that the levels of aspartate transaminase, blood urea nitrogen, and creatinine, alongside the activities of gamma-glutamyl transpeptidase, were higher in the diseased ponies in comparison to the controls. These heightened values indicate possible impairment of liver and kidney functions.
  • However, these values gradually returned to normal during the postconvalescent phase.

Hyperinsulinemia and Insulin Resistance

  • During the acute phase of hyperlipemia, ponies demonstrated hyperinsulinemia – a condition characterized by excessive levels of insulin in the blood.
  • Intravenous glucose tolerance tests were performed on two of the ponies, which showed an exaggerated insulin response. This suggests decreased insulin sensitivity in hyperlipemic ponies, meaning these ponies may be insulin-resistant.
